Gold price down by Rs 500 per tola



KATHMANDU: Gold price decreased by Rs 500 per tola (11.664 grams) in the domestic market on Monday.

According to the Federation of Nepal Gold and Silver Dealers Association (FENEGOSIDA), the precious yellow metal is being traded at Rs 97,900 per total today.

The gold price was Rs 98,400 per tola yesterday.

Likewise, tejabi gold has been priced at Rs 97,400 and silver at Rs 1,320 today.
